
Vijayawada (Andhra Pradesh), April 13 (ANI): The Yuvajana Sramika Rythu Congress Party (YSRCP), led by former Chief Minister YS Jagan Mohan Reddy, has restructured its Political Action Committee (PAC), naming Sajjala Ramakrishna Reddy as its new coordinator.
Sajjala, who is also the General Secretary of YSRCP, previously served as the Public Affairs Advisor to the Andhra Pradesh government during Jagan’s tenure from 2019 to 2024.

The 33-member PAC includes a mix of prominent political leaders, MLAs, MLCs, MPs, and regional heavyweights. Notable members include:
- Tammineni Sitaram
- Pedika Rajanna Dora
- Mudragada Padmanabham
- Kodali Sri Venkateswara Rao (Nani)
- Vidadala Rajini
- RK Roja
- Buggana Rajendranath Reddy
- Adimulapu Suresh
- Poluboina Anil Kumar Yadav
The only Lok Sabha MP in the PAC is Avinash Reddy, while Rajya Sabha MPs Golla Baburao, Pilli Subhash Chandra Bose, and Alla Ayodhya Rami Reddy have also been inducted.
The party added that regional coordinators will serve as permanent invitees to the PAC, strengthening its organizational outreach and grassroots connect.

🔹 Political Tensions and Allegations:
The announcement comes amid political tensions ahead of elections in the state. On Saturday, former minister Perni Nani accused CM Chandrababu Naidu of obstructing Jagan Mohan Reddy’s travel to meet the family of a slain party worker, Kuruba Lingamaiah.
In another controversy, YSRCP has accused the Tirumala Tirupati Devasthanams (TTD) of neglect at a cow shelter, alleging the deaths of nearly 100 cows due to mismanagement. TTD, however, has denied these allegations.
